Output 24f0ad830193fbbde24d218c8b67520f56f9606db8ea461608ce6e49edb87da2:0

value
1014594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f54c2a9eb34b46da53e8413f7d80f1dd400cf92a OP_EQUAL
address
3Q42igXW7V1FRqRVv6PH9zo15FNJshAZJB
transaction
24f0ad830193fbbde24d218c8b67520f56f9606db8ea461608ce6e49edb87da2
spent
true